I have found that if I set my side image range to 40' and no more than 60' on each side that I am able to see fish better on my HB 899 unit. Look for the rice grain slivers with shadows showing off to the side on the bottom of lake. This is fish some what off the bottom of the lake water column. The more you use your unit the more you will learn what you are seeing on it. Remember tho that the further the range the smaller the images will be especially on the smaller screen units.
